Football League World have reported that Fulham are being considered as the next possible destination for Tottenham defender, Cameron Carter-Vickers.
Fulham have reportedly been in touch with Spurs and are now being considered by the North London club as a potential transfer destination.
The report even goes as far as to say that Fulham are at the front of the queue for Carter-Vickers, ahead of Celtic who have also apparently shown interest.
A recent report from the Daily Record, also revealed Celtic’s interest, adding that Spurs were looking for around £5m for the centre-back.
Alasdair Gold from Football London reported last week that there has been ‘plenty’ of interest in Carter-Vickers this summer as he has just one year left on his contract.
The USA international played a part in some of the early pre-season games under new head coach Nuno Espirito Santo this summer.
Although he has made just four senior Spurs appearances, Carter-Vickers has enjoyed loan spells at Sheffield United, Ipswich Town, Swansea City, Stoke City, Luton Town, and AFC Bournemouth.
